Opinion Unafraid to take the lead

Vidya Balan put herself first,in an industry where a woman’s ultimate ambition is to play second fiddle to a superstar Khan

December 9, 2011 03:47 AM IST First published on: Dec 9, 2011 at 03:47 AM IST

Who doesn’t love comeuppance? Cinema thrives on it. People like you and I wait for it. If life is kind,there comes a defining moment — a reset button — when everything is evened out. The past with its failures,disappointments and sniggers stops to matter. You’ve got to earn this power of reset,but once you do,the user’s guide is fairly simple: you hit once,but hard. And then just ride the wave. Much like Vidya Balan.

Vidya Balan,currently being hailed as the “only hero” amongst the heroines,has gone far in getting the box office,ummm… dirty. The six-day total of The Dirty Picture (TDP) is an impressive Rs 49. 23 crore. (The net box office collections breakdown: Friday: Rs 9.54 crore,Saturday: Rs 10.78 crore,Sunday: Rs 12.38 crore,Monday: Rs 5.72 crore,Tuesday: Rs 6.21 crore,Wednesday: Rs 4.6 crore). This is massive booty. Trends predict that TDP will cross the first-week collections of Hrithik Roshan-Farhan Akhtar starrer Zindagi Na Milegi Dobara. The “only hero” claim doesn’t seem too far-fetched now,does it?

Paa,Ishqiya,No One Killed Jessica and now The Dirty Picture. It’s quite a little era that Ms. Balan is knitting for herself. So when did Vidya become the nation’s ooh la la fantasy? When did she get her mojo on?

The Vidya Balan renaissance occurred at the same time that her contemporaries decided to go for the blockbuster formula — become the decorative pieces in the big set-up with a superstar Khan in the lead. Let’s break it down: for all her box office clout and signing spree with the Khans,the biggest noise that Kareena Kapoor made this year was for her dance number Chammak Challo. Katrina Kaif’s biggest calling card is still Sheila Ki Jawani. Priyanka Chopra’s last hit was Dostana in 2008. Balan,in the meantime,went about consolidating her chips as a performer,never mind the Khans. For her,it became all about if you can’t join ’em,well then,beat ’em.

Vidya Balan’s been around. After a spate of TV commercials,a few Euphoria music videos and a television stint in Ekta Kapoor’s Hum Paanch,she earned her dream debut in Pradeep Sarkar’s Parineeta. Producer Vidhu Vinod Chopra,however,approved her after 17 make-up shoots and 40 screen tests. She followed that up with her chirpy “Goooooodmorning Mumbai” gig in Lage Raho Munnabhai. Then Phase 2 happened. She was clobbered for her frumpy dress sense in Heyy Babyy and her teenybopper attempt in Kismet Konnection opposite Shahid Kapoor was painful to watch.

She also knows it,so I’ll say it,but people behind her back used to call her “Vidya aunty” and comparisons with Gracy Singh were being circulated as SMS jokes. It was during this phase that she discovered her reset button. She took time off and came back with a new strategy. She became the go-to girl for all that was forbidden for her contemporaries. So when the other girls were getting page-one hits for being size zero and getting the bikini jitters,Vidya was out there sucking her co-star’s thumbs.

The Dirty Picture is a game-changer,not just for Vidya,but for an industry always hesitant to put faith in a woman-driven subject. Ekta Kapoor and her leading lady have shown the way it can be done. These are the real desi girls,who have stolen the thunder of all the Desi Boyz.
